1335.2200 FLOODPROOFING REGULATIONS, SECTION 802.1.

FPR section 802.1 is amended to read as follows:

Applicability: Spaces to be intentionally flooded with flood water (W4) shall be provided with the necessary equipment, devices, piping, controls, etc. necessary for automatic flooding during the flood event and drainage system(s) shall utilize approved piping materials and have sufficient capacity for raising or lowering the internal water level at a rate comparable to the anticipated rate of rise and fall of a flood that would reach the RFD. These pipe systems shall be directly connected to the external flood waters to maintain a balanced internal and external water pressure condition. Provisions shall be made for filling the lower portions of the structure first and for interconnections through or around all floors and partitions to prevent unbalanced filling of chambers or parts within the structures. All spaces below the RFD shall be provided with air vents extending to at least three feet above the elevation of the RFD to prevent the trapping of air by the rising water surface. All openings to the filling and drainage systems shall be protected by screens or grilles to prevent the entry or nesting of rodents or birds in the systems.
